Check your building codes for any special
requirements for locating equipment shutoff
valve to appliance.
Apply pipe joint sealant lightly to male NPT
threads. This will prevent excess sealant from
going into pipe. Excess sealant in pipe could
result in a clogged burner orifice.
WARNING: Use pipe joint
sealant that is resistant to liquid
petroleum (LP) gas.
We recommend that you install a sediment
trap in supply line as shown in Figure 3.
Locate sediment trap where it is within reach
for cleaning. Install in piping system between
fuel supply and heater. Locate sediment trap
where trapped matter is not likely to freeze.
A sediment trap traps moisture and contami
-
nants. This keeps them from going into log set
controls. If sediment trap is not installed or is
installed wrong, log set may not run properly.

CHECKING GAS CONNECTIONS
WARNING: Test all gas piping
and connections for leaks after
installing or servicing. Correct
all leaks at once.
WARNING: Never use an
open flame to check for a leak.
Apply a noncorrosive leak detec
-
tion fluid to all joints. Bubbles
forming show a leak. Correct all
leaks at once.
PRESSURE TESTING GAS SUPPLy
PIPING SYSTEM
Test Pressures In Excess Of 1/2 PSIG
(3.5 kPa)
1. Disconnect log set and its individual equip
-
ment shutoff valve from gas supply piping
system.
2. Cap off open end of gas pipe where equip
-
ment shutoff valve was connected.
3. Pressurize supply piping system by either
opening propane/LP supply tank valve
for propane/LP gas or opening main gas
valve located on or near gas meter for
natural gas, or using compressed air.
4. Check all joints of gas supply piping system.
Apply noncorrosive leak detection fluid to
all joints. Bubbles forming show a leak.
5. Correct all leaks at once.
6. Reconnect log set and equipment shutoff
valve to gas supply. Check reconnected
fittings for leaks.
